    Contract Signed. DIRECT CENTRAL PARK VIEWS PRICED TO SELL! Perched high above the trees, this fabulous apartment offers glorious sweeping views of Central Park and beyond. Enjoy watching the Macy's Thanksgiving Day Parade and the NYC Marathon all from the convenience of your own home - or just cross the street and enjoy having Central Park as your front yard. Within two blocks of The Shops at Columbus Circle, Fifth Avenue boutiques, top restaurants, Whole Foods, The Plaza and Carnegie Hall as well as moments from Lincoln Center and Broadway theatres, The Berkeley House offers security, comfort, convenience and style in the heart of New York City. This white glove pre-war cooperative offers 24 hour doorman and concierge and on-site laundry. The building allows pied-a-terre ownership and small pets. This lovely and spacious two bedroom home offers a gracious foyer, large step down living room, two full renovated bathrooms and a large, updated windowed eat-in-kitchen. Building has a buyer paid flip tax of 3% of sale price.
